Black History Month Poetry Reading
February 24, 2021 @ 6:30 pm – 8:00 pm
Join us for a free poetry reading featuring poets and writers who collaborated on the anthology, ENOUGH: Say Their Names…Messages from Ground Zero to the WORLD, an historic book depicting events following the death of George Floyd through writing and poetry, the board-up artwork, and photography that speak to the need for justice and equality through Black Lives Matter.
This book includes fresh, compelling, and diverse perspectives for readers of all levels and awareness. This anthology includes writers from across the country who share their work and how it relates to the art of a movement. The authors “hope permanent meaningful changes made now will make many of these tough conversations unnecessary for future generations.”
